Output 13d60441980de31384faf603a6938cec8361d450387f024c6a2f9fc87735db16:0

value
2659706
script pubkey
OP_HASH160 OP_PUSHBYTES_20 717b39b7f06e9a6bf19997ef3c42dc367525b2d6 OP_EQUAL
address
3C33u5MS1JE4ZmEp2RiLN4nH9oCgcvE53A
transaction
13d60441980de31384faf603a6938cec8361d450387f024c6a2f9fc87735db16
spent
true